按上图中的操作步骤:先给 Area2D ( Coin )添加一个空脚本,然后点击发出信号的节点 Area2D ( Coin ),在 Node 面板的 Signals 下显示了 Area2D 节点的所有信号种类,这里我们选择 body_entered(PhysicsBody2D body) 也就是碰撞体进入信号,双击它或者单击右下方的 Connect… 按钮,在弹出框中选择接收该信号的订阅...
godot_8_connect_signal.png 按上图中的操作步骤:先给Area2D(Coin)添加一个空脚本,然后点击发出信号的节点Area2D(Coin),在 Node 面板的 Signals 下显示了Area2D节点的所有信号种类,这里我们选择body_entered(PhysicsBody2D body)也就是碰撞体进入信号,双击它或者单击右下方的Connect...按钮,在弹出框中选择接收该信...
发送信号对象.connect(信号名, 当前类/self , 当前类函数名字符串) 补充 这里我把所有的·事件·都改为了·信号·,对应api的名称 信号的链接不需要销毁,游戏系统是自动处理这些任务的 官方文档: https://docs.godotengine.org/en/3.1/getting_started/step_by_step/signals.html ...
选择节点如Button,然后选择Node选项卡,确保已经开启信号Signals 选择节点的事件如pressed(),点击右下角的Connect...打开创建连接对话框 蓝色突出显示的是信号来源 选择信号接收节点 即可自动建立信号处理方法,如_on_[EmitterNode]_[signal_name] #常用函数Node.get.node()用法示例#1获取Butt...
编辑器中有连接信号到脚本的界面:选中场景树中的节点,然后选择“节点”选项卡,再选中其中的"Signals"选项卡。 此时我们主要对"pressed"信号感兴趣。除了可用可视化界面来完成信号连接操作,也可以通过脚本代码来进行。 针对这种情况,Godot的程序员可能用得最多的一个函数: ...
编辑器中有连接信号到脚本的界面:选中场景树中的节点,然后选择“节点”选项卡,再选中其中的"Signals"选项卡。 此时我们主要对"pressed"信号感兴趣。除了可用可视化界面来完成信号连接操作,也可以通过脚本代码来进行。 针对这种情况,Godot的程序员可能用得最多的一个函数: ...
编辑器中有连接信号到脚本的界面:选中场景树中的节点,然后选择“节点”选项卡,再选中其中的"Signals"选项卡。 此时我们主要对"pressed"信号感兴趣。除了可用可视化界面来完成信号连接操作,也可以通过脚本代码来进行。 针对这种情况,Godot的程序员可能用得最多的一个函数: ...
1._enter_tree()vs_ready() [reddit] enter_tree() vs. ready(), etc. Are there rules of thumb regarding which initialization function to do my housekeeping? 2. 如何用脚本 connect signals? [reddit] explain to me how to use the signals in Godot, please. ...
Signals are a way for objects in a Godot scene to communicate with each other. When an object emits a signal, any other object that is connected to that signal will receive a notification and can respond accordingly. How do I use signals? Touse signals, you first need to create a signal...
2. 如何用脚本connect signals? [reddit] explain to me how to use the signals in Godot, please. 3. collision layer 和 collision mask有什么区别 [GodotQ&A] What's the difference between Collision layers and Collision masks?[GodotQ&A] Collision masks and its propper uses ...